WTMF vs MDIV
WisdomTree Managed Futures Strategy Fund vs Multi-Asset Diversified Income Index Fund
Key differences
WTMF is an alternative ETF, while MDIV is a mixed asset ETF. WTMF charges 0.66% a year and MDIV 0.71%.
- WTMF is an alternative fund, while MDIV is a mixed asset fund. They carry different risk/return profiles.
- WTMF follows a managed futures strategy; MDIV uses index tracking.
- Over the last three years, MDIV has delivered higher annualized returns.
Side-by-side comparison
| WTMF | MDIV | |
|---|---|---|
| Annual cost (TER) | 0.66% | 0.71% |
| Fund size (AUM) | $235M | $411M |
| Since | 2011 | 2012 |
| Dividend yield | 2.80% | 6.38% |
| Asset class | alternative | mixed asset |
| Region | north america | north america |
| Strategy | managed futures | index tracking |
| CAGR 1Y | +20.2% | +12.3% |
| CAGR 3Y | +9.7% | +11.4% |
| CAGR 5Y | +6.1% | +5.9% |
| Sharpe 3Y | 0.69 | 0.85 |
| Volatility 1Y | 8.93% | 6.71% |
| Max drawdown | -15.62% | -48.50% |
